NISSAN TITAN 2008 User Guide Turn signal/hazard indicator
lights
The appropriate light flashes when the turn signal
switch is activated.
Both lights flash when the hazard switch is turned
on.

NISSAN TITAN 2008 User Guide Door and liftgate open warning
This warning illuminates when a door, the liftgate
or the liftgate glass has been opened when the
engine is running.

NISSAN TITAN 2008 User Guide To sound the horn, push the center pad area of
the steering wheel.
